State ex rel. Hayes v. Board of Equalization

Citations

  • 16 S.D. 219
  • 92 N.W. 16
  • 1902 S.D. LEXIS 101

Syllabus

<p>Under Const, art. 11, § 6, authorizing exemption from taxation of property “used exclusively” for charitable purposes, a building owned by a charitable institution, but part of which is used for a store, cannot be exempt, though the rents are used for charitable purposes.</p>
